gynecology
Pronunciation
  • (British) IPA: /ˌɡaɪnɪˈkɒlədʒi/, /ˌdʒaɪnɪˈkɒlədʒi/ (archaic)
  • (America) IPA: /ˌɡaɪnəˈkɑlədʒi/, /ˌdʒaɪnəˈkɑlədʒi/ (archaic)
Noun

gynecology (uncountable) (American spelling)

  1. The study of, or the branch of medicine specializing in, the medical problems of women, especially disorders of the reproductive organs.
